This villa is located on the eastern coast of the Peloponnese in Greece, a short drive from the village of Ermioni. Ermioni, formerly Hermione, is a quaint little village that sits on an outcrop facing the island of Hydra. Although it does not have a sandy beach, it is still quite possible to go swimming. The primary industry here is still fishing, and because the high speed Dolphin boats stop here it is easy to get to and from the nearby islands. There are also some interesting ruins at one end of town. Conveniences include a bank, police station, post office, and town square. Nearby Kranidi is the provincial capital. This larger town has beaches, windmills, and historic sights like the chapels of Santa Anna and Pantanassa, cared for by nuns (female visitors please wear skirts). In addition to the towns many other chapels and churches, you will find the church of St Anagyroi, where there are woodcuts and a library of rare manuscripts. Another fun excursion is the island of Hydra, where there are no cars. The only means of transportation here are donkeys, water taxis, and your own two feet! Fortunately everything is within walking distance, and there are many water and outdoor activities available. If you're interested in Greek myth, Troizina (formerly Troezen) was the birthplace of Theseus, and is reportedly the location of a spring where Pegasus once touched the ground.

(2,000 m2) This private villa is built on an incline within its own fenced, partly landscaped property. It sits almost on the water's edge, just above a rocky shore. The exterior area is comprised of a garden with a large, oval-shaped swimming pool (40 m2, fresh water) and a sun terrace with thatch umbrellas. There is a dining table for "al fresco" meals as well as sun lounges for just being lazy! There is also a built-in barbecue and outdoor parking. Because this villa is built on an incline there are some steps out of doors.

Ground Floor: This villa has a living room with a sofa bed (suitable for one) and an exit to the pool terrace. It is also equipped with a TV, DVD player, and CD player. The dining area has two tables for a total of 12 seats. An open-plan kitchen is equipped with an oven, cook-top, dishwasher, coffee machine, espresso machine, and a washing machine. This floor has one bedroom with a 160 cm queen-size bed, air conditioning, and an exterior door. A bathroom has a sink, toilet, and shower.
First Floor: Upstairs there is a split-level floor. The lower level contains a large hallway used as a sitting room with a fireplace and a sofa-bed suitable for one. It exits to a spacious veranda with a pergola looking over the pool and sea. There is also a small bedroom with one single bed and a fan. The upper level of the first floor has one bedroom with a 160 cm queen-size bed and air conditioning. A second bedroom has a single bed. They share a bathroom with a sink, toilet, and shower.
